Delve into a captivating conversation between legendary mountaineer Reinhold Messner and accomplished rock climber Steph Davis as they explore the intricate relationship between mountain and human nature. Gain insights into Messner's passionate quest to preserve the ideals of traditional alpinism. Discover how these two renowned adventurers navigate the challenges and rewards of pursuing alpinism as a lifestyle. Learn about the physical and mental demands of high-altitude mountaineering, rock climbing, and other extreme sports. Examine the evolving landscape of alpinism and its impact on both individuals and the environment. Reflect on the importance of sustainable practices in outdoor pursuits and the role of adventure in personal growth and self-discovery. This thought-provoking discussion, presented as part of the Murdock Mind, Body, Spirit Series, offers a unique perspective on the intersection of human ambition and the raw power of nature.
